Serie A: Atalanta's Winless Home Streak Continues with 2-0 Loss to Inter Milan


Inter Milan moved three points clear at the top of Serie A with a 2-0 win over Atalanta, thanks to goals from Carlos Augusto and Lautaro Martinez. The victory marked Inter's first away win in the league since 2024.



Inter Milan solidified their position at the top of the Serie A standings with a crucial 2-0 win over third-placed Atalanta. This victory marked Inter's third win over Atalanta this season, with the Nerazzurri keeping a clean sheet in each of those matches.


The match between the division's joint-highest scorers began with a flurry of chances. In the seventh minute, Lautaro Martinez's expert pass unlocked the Atalanta defense, sending Marcus Thuram through on goal. Thuram beat goalkeeper Marco Carnesecchi, but his finish clipped the inside of the post and came out. Atalanta responded with a significant opportunity of their own, but Yann Sommer made a superb save to deny Mario Pasalic's header from Marten de Roon's cross.


As the match progressed, defenses gained the upper hand, with wayward efforts from Alessandro Bastoni and Ademola Lookman being the closest either side came to breaking the deadlock before halftime. Atalanta's recent struggles to score at home continued, with their previous two matches at the Gewiss Stadium ending goalless.


Inter eventually broke the deadlock in the 54th minute, when Hakan Calhanoglu's pinpoint corner was headed home by the unmarked Carlos Augusto. Augusto's goal marked his third in the league this campaign, and it paved the way for Inter's crucial win.


Following Carlos Augusto's opening goal, Inter Milan continued to press for a second. Hakan Calhanoglu attempted a shot from 25 yards, but Marco Carnesecchi made a comfortable save. Lautaro Martinez then thought he had doubled Inter's lead, but his goal was disallowed due to a foul on Berat Djimsiti in the build-up.


As the match entered its final stages, Atalanta struggled to create scoring opportunities. It wasn't until the 80th minute that they finally managed a shot on target in the second half, but Lazar Samardzic's tame effort was easily saved by Yann Sommer.


The evening took a turn for the worse for Atalanta when Ederson was booked twice in quick succession. First, he was cautioned for fouling Marcus Thuram, and then he received a second yellow card for reacting to referee Davide Massa's decision. Inter Milan capitalized on the numerical advantage, and Lautaro Martinez sealed the win with a powerful shot past Carnesecchi four minutes from time.


The victory marked Inter Milan's first away win in the league since 2024, despite Alessandro Bastoni being sent off in added time. Meanwhile, Atalanta's winless streak at home in Serie A continued, and manager Gian Piero Gasperini was also dismissed.
